CSS样式属性中文详解

需积分: 9 4 下载量 123 浏览量 更新于2024-09-09 收藏 154KB DOC 举报
"CSS规则英汉对照表" 在网页设计中,CSS(Cascading Style Sheets)是一种用于控制网页元素样式的语言。本资源提供了一份详细的CSS规则英汉对照表,帮助用户理解和应用各种CSS属性。 一、类型 1. `font-family`: 设置字体,可以指定多个字体作为备选,以防某些字体在用户的计算机上不可用。 2. `font-size`: 设置字体大小,可以使用像素、百分比、em等单位。 3. `font-weight`: 设置字体的粗细,如`normal`、`bold`或数值100-900。 4. `font-style`: 控制字体样式,如`italic`表示斜体,`normal`表示正常。 5. `font-variant`: 设定字体为正常显示或小型大写字母。 6. `line-height`: 设置行高,影响文本的垂直间距。 7. `text-transform`: 转换文本的大小写,如`uppercase`、`lowercase`或`capitalize`。 8. `text-decoration`: 控制文本装饰,包括`underline`下划线、`overline`上划线、`line-through`删除线和`none`无装饰。 二、背景 1. `background-color`: 设置元素的背景颜色。 2. `background-image`: 设置背景图像,可以是URL或者渐变等。 3. `background-repeat`: 控制背景图像是否及如何重复,如`repeat`、`no-repeat`、`repeat-x`或`repeat-y`。 4. `background-attachment`: 设置背景图像是否固定或随滚动条移动,可选值有`scroll`和`fixed`。 5. `background-position`: 定义背景图像的初始位置,可以是像素、百分比或关键字。 三、区块 1. `word-spacing`: 调整单词间的间距。 2. `letter-spacing`: 控制字符之间的间距。 3. `vertical-align`: 垂直对齐文本,如`top`、`bottom`、`middle`或相对于基线的百分比。 4. `text-align`: 水平对齐文本,可以是`left`、`right`、`center`或`justify`。 5. `text-indent`: 设置段落首行的缩进。 6. `white-space`: 控制元素内的空白处理,如`normal`、`nowrap`或`pre`。 7. `display`: 决定元素的显示方式,如`block`、`inline`、`none`或`flex`。 四、方框 1. `width`和`height`: 分别设置元素的宽度和高度。 2. `float`: 让元素浮动到左侧(`left`)或右侧(`right`),影响周围元素的布局。 3. `clear`: 防止元素被浮动元素覆盖,可选`both`、`left`、`right`或`none`。 4. `padding`: 设置元素内容区域与边框之间的距离。 5. `margin`: 定义元素与其周围元素的距离,可以是四周的统一值或单独设置。 五、边框 1. `border-style`: 边框样式,如`solid`实线、`dashed`虚线、`dotted`点线等。 2. `border-width`: 设置边框的宽度。 3. `border-color`: 设定边框颜色。 六、列表 1. `list-style-type`: 自定义列表项的标记类型,如`disc`圆点、`square`方块或`decimal`数字。 2. `list-style-image`: 使用图像作为列表项标记。 3. `list-style-position`: 指定列表项标记的位置,是`inside`还是`outside`元素内容。 七、定位 1. `position`: 控制元素的定位,如`static`(默认)、`relative`、`absolute`或`fixed`。 2. `width`和`height`: 用于绝对定位时设置元素的尺寸。 3. `visibility`: 规定元素是否可见,`visible`表示可见,`hidden`表示隐藏但保留空间。 4. `z-index`: 定义元素的堆叠顺序,数值越大,元素越靠前。 以上就是CSS规则的一些基本概念和用法,这些属性可以组合使用,实现丰富的网页设计效果。理解并熟练掌握这些规则,将有助于创建更具吸引力和功能性的网页界面。